doc/CMakeLists.txt
changeset 376 2fd7fd2ee1a1
parent 374 1862c5f2cfc3
child 396 e1a24791d192
equal deleted inserted replaced
375:5fdc1627859d 376:2fd7fd2ee1a1
     7 # Where to install doxygen output
     7 # Where to install doxygen output
     8 set(PROJECT_DOXYGEN_DIR "${PROJECT_SOURCE_DIR}/doc")
     8 set(PROJECT_DOXYGEN_DIR "${PROJECT_SOURCE_DIR}/doc")
     9 
     9 
    10 IF (DOXYGEN_FOUND)
    10 IF (DOXYGEN_FOUND)
    11     # doxygen.conf.in -> doxygen.conf
    11     # doxygen.conf.in -> doxygen.conf
    12     MESSAGE (STATUS "configure ${CMAKE_CURRENT_SOURCE_DIR}/doxygen.conf.in --> ${CMAKE_CURRENT_SOURCE_DIR}/doxygen.conf")
    12     MESSAGE (STATUS "Doxygen: configure ${CMAKE_CURRENT_SOURCE_DIR}/doxygen.conf.in --> ${CMAKE_CURRENT_SOURCE_DIR}/doxygen.conf")
    13 
    13 
    14     CONFIGURE_FILE (
    14     CONFIGURE_FILE (
    15         ${CMAKE_CURRENT_SOURCE_DIR}/doxygen.conf.in
    15         ${CMAKE_CURRENT_SOURCE_DIR}/doxygen.conf.in
    16         ${CMAKE_CURRENT_BINARY_DIR}/doxygen.conf
    16         ${CMAKE_CURRENT_BINARY_DIR}/doxygen.conf
    17         @ONLY
    17         @ONLY
    24     ADD_CUSTOM_TARGET(
    24     ADD_CUSTOM_TARGET(
    25         doc 
    25         doc 
    26         ${DOXYGEN_EXECUTABLE} ${DOXYGEN_CONFIG}
    26         ${DOXYGEN_EXECUTABLE} ${DOXYGEN_CONFIG}
    27     )
    27     )
    28     
    28     
    29     MESSAGE (STATUS "doxygen output will be installed in ${PROJECT_DOXYGEN_DIR}")
    29     MESSAGE (STATUS "Doxygen: output will be installed in ${PROJECT_DOXYGEN_DIR}")
    30 
    30 
    31 ENDIF (DOXYGEN_FOUND)
    31 ENDIF (DOXYGEN_FOUND)
    32 
    32